4.使用Array函数创建一个新的空数组:这种方法会创建一个新的空数组,并替换原来的数组。例如,如果你有一个名为myArray的数组,你可以使用以下代码来清空它:5.使用Clear方法清除字典中的键值对:如果你的数组是一个字典,你可以使用Clear方法来清除所有的键值对。例如,如果你有一个名为myDict的字典,你可以使用...
Me.ListBox1.List =Array("国庆节", "中秋节", "元旦", "春节") 给列表框添加了4个节日名。 4.可以使用Array函数创建控件数组,即将控件名称作为Array函数的参数。然后,可以将数组元素当作相应的控件对象来使用,例如: Private Su...
23 ActiveSheet.Move After:=ActiveWorkbook.Sheets(ActiveWorkbook.Sheets.Count) 将当前工作表移至工作表的最后 24 Worksheets(Array(“sheet1”,”sheet2”)).Select 同时选择工作表1和工作表2 25 Sheets(“sheet1”).Delete或 Sheets(1).Delete 删除工作表1 26 ActiveWorkbook.Sheets(i).Name 获...
m_capacity=TotalCapacityEnd PropertyPublicFunctionLength()AsLong'includes only used elements in the arrayLength =m_sizeEnd FunctionPrivateSubtrimToSize()'If capacity is large and length < 50% of capacity,'trim total capacity to: (number of used elements * 1.5)Ifm_capacity >99ThenIf(m_size < ...
注意,代码中使用Clear方法删除ArrayList中的所有元素项。 复制ArrayList到数组 ToArray方法可以将ArrayList复制到数组: Sub testClone() Dim alColl As Object Set alColl = CreateObject("System.Collections.ArrayList") '添加元素 alColl.Add "完美Excel" ...
ScreenUpdating = FalseDim Fname'定义表头数组Fname = Array("格式名称", "原数据", "数字", "货币", "负数", "文本")Dim cell As Range, xcell As RangeSet cell = ActiveSheet.Range("A2:F2")cell.Value = Fname'设置表头Set cell = ActiveSheet.Range("B3:B15")'定义数据区域With cell.Clear....
HasArray属性 该属性只读,返回指定单元格是否包含在含有数组公式的单元格区域。 如下图所示的工作表,其中单元格区域H2:H7含有数组公式。由于单元格H2在数组单元格区域中,因此其HasArray属性返回True;而单元格I2不在数组单元格区域中,因此...
("a:b").Clear '清空数据Range("a:a").NumberFormat = "@" '设置文本格式 For Each sht In Worksheets '遍历工作表取表名 k = k + 1 Cells(k, 1) = sht.Name Next Range("a1:b1") = Array("工作表名", "是否删除") Application.ScreenUpdating = True End Sub 04.删除指定工作表 Sub Del...
SubQQ1722187970()DimoWKAsWorksheetSetoWK=ActiveSheetoWK.Cells.Cleararr=VBA.Array("引用的名称","引用的路径","GUID","Major","Minor","说明")iCol=UBound(arr)+1oWK.Range("a1").Resize(1,iCol)=arrWithoWK i=2'遍历所有的引用 For Each oref In ThisWorkbook.VBProject.References ...
arrInt(3) = 4CallGetArray(arrInt)' 在立即窗口打印出' Item 0: 1' Item 1: 2' Item 2: 3' Item 3: 4EndSub 但对于对象来说,使用ByVal实际上传递的仍然是对对象的引用,这样在过程中对象的修改将会影响过程外部对象的值或属性。如果使用ByVal,而在过程中创建一个新的对象实例,将该对象赋值给传递的...